Preparation and Cooking Time
Preparing High Protein Slow Cooker Garlic Butter Beef Bites is straightforward and efficient. Below is the breakdown of the total time you’ll need:
– Preparation Time: 15 minutes
– Cooking Time: 6 to 8 hours (depending on the slow cooker setting)
– Total Time: Approximately 6 to 8 hours and 15 minutes

Ingredients
– 2 pounds beef chuck roast, cut into bite-sized pieces
– 1 cup unsalted butter
– 1 tablespoon minced garlic
– 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
– 1 teaspoon onion powder
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 1 teaspoon paprika
– ½ teaspoon salt (or to taste)
– ½ teaspoon black pepper (or to taste)
–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
– Optional: Green onions, chopped (for garnish)
Step-by-Step Instructions
Creating High Protein Slow Cooker Garlic Butter Beef Bites is easy if you follow these simple steps:
1. Prepare Beef: Cut the beef chuck roast into bite-sized pieces and season with salt, black pepper, onion powder, and paprika.
2. Melt Butter: In a small saucepan over low heat, melt the unsalted butter. Add minced garlic and sauté for about 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
3. Combine Ingredients: In the slow cooker, combine the seasoned beef pieces with Worcestershire sauce. Pour the melted garlic butter mixture over the beef, ensuring all pieces are well coated.
4. Cook: Set your slow cooker to low heat and cover. Let it cook for 6 to 8 hours, or until the beef is fork-tender.
5. Stir Occasionally: If possible, stir the beef mixture a couple of times during cooking to ensure even flavor distribution.
6. Garnish: Once cooked, remove the beef bites from the slow cooker. Top with chopped parsley and green onions before serving, if desired.
7. Serve: Enjoy your amazing beef bites as a main dish, paired with your favorite sides.

Additional Tips
– Select the Right Cut of Meat: Use beef chuck roast for its tenderness and flavor. It’s perfect for slow cooking, ensuring the bites are succulent.
– Sauté Garlic: For an extra kick in flavor, consider sautéing the minced garlic just until golden. This will enhance the garlic’s natural sweetness.
– Spice It Up: Feel free to adjust the spices to suit your taste. Adding a pinch of cayenne pepper can give your beef bites a nice, spicy kick.
– Experiment with Herbs: If you prefer fresh herbs, try adding rosemary or thyme for an aromatic touch during cooking.
Recipe Variation
Mix things up with these exciting variations:
1. Asian-Inspired Bites: Add soy sauce instead of Worcestershire sauce, and include ginger for an Asian twist. Serve over steamed rice.
2. Smoky Flavor: Incorporate smoked paprika and a dash of liquid smoke for a barbecue-inspired flavor profile.
3. Creamy Version: After cooking, stir in a cup of sour cream or cream cheese to create a rich, creamy sauce.
Freezing and Storage
– Storage: Keep any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They are best enjoyed within 3-4 days.
– Freezing: These beef bites freeze well. Just ensure they are cooled completely before transferring to freezer-safe bags. They can last up to 3 months frozen.

Frequently Asked Questions
How long can I cook the beef bites in the slow cooker?
You can cook the beef bites for anywhere between 6 to 8 hours on low heat. Ensure that the meat is fork-tender before serving.
Can I use a different cut of beef?
Yes, you can use other cuts such as sirloin or brisket; however, chuck roast is recommended for its tenderness in slow cooking.
Is this recipe suitable for a gluten-free diet?
Yes, simply replace the Worcestershire sauce with a gluten-free alternative. Ensure all other ingredients are certified gluten-free.
What can I serve with these beef bites?
These beef bites are versatile. Pair them with mashed potatoes, rice, or roasted vegetables for a complete meal.
Can I double the recipe?
Absolutely! Just ensure your slow cooker has enough capacity to accommodate the additional ingredients. You may need to increase the cooking time slightly.
